Jesus, himself, taught the Old Testament prophecies pointed to him.
John 5:39 – You study the Scriptures diligently because you think that in them you have eternal life. These are the very Scriptures that testify about me.
Luke 24:27, 44 – And beginning with Moses and the prophets, Jesus expounded to them in all the Scriptures all the things concerning himself…Everything must be fulfilled that is written about me in the Law of Moses, the Prophets and the Psalms.”
Below are just a few of those prophecies Jesus said testify of him.
1. Jesus will be from the bloodline of David.
Jeremiah 23:5-6 – “Behold, the days are coming, declares the LORD, when I will raise up for David a righteous Branch, and he shall reign as king and deal wisely, and shall execute justice and righteousness in the land. 6 In his days Judah will be saved, and Israel will dwell securely. And this is the name by which he will be called: ‘The LORD is our righteousness. (See also 2 Sam 7:12-16; Is 11:1)
Matthew 1:1 – This is the genealogy of Jesus the Messiah the son of David, the son of Abraham:…
2. Jesus will be born of a virgin.
Isaiah 7:14 – Therefore the Lord himself will give you a sign: The virgin will conceive and give birth to a son,…
Matthew 1:18, 22-23 – Mary was pledged to be married to Joseph, but before they came together, she was found to be pregnant through the Holy Spirit… All this took place to fulfill what the Lord had said through the prophet: 23 “The virgin will conceive and give birth to a son, and they will call him Immanuel” (which means “God with us”).
3. Jesus will be born in Bethlehem.
Micah 5:2 – “But you, Bethlehem Ephrathah, though you are small among the clans of Judah, out of you will come for me one who will be ruler over Israel, whose origins are from of old, from ancient times.”
Luke 1:4-7 – So Joseph also went up from the town of Nazareth in Galilee to Judea, to Bethlehem… While they were there, the time came for the baby to be born, and Mary gave birth to her firstborn, a son.
4. Jesus will live in Egypt.
Hosea 11:1 – When Israel was a youth I loved him, And out of Egypt I called My son.
Matthew 2:13-15 – …an angel of the Lord appeared to Joseph in a dream. “Get up,” he said, “take the child and his mother and escape to Egypt… And so was fulfilled what the Lord had said through the prophet: “Out of Egypt I called my son.”
5. Jesus will be worshipped as royalty.
Numbers 24:17 – “I see him, but not now; I behold him, but not near. A star will come out of Jacob; a scepter will rise out of Israel.
Matthew 2:1-2 – After Jesus was born in Bethlehem in Judea, during the time of King Herod, Magi from the east came to Jerusalem and asked, “Where is the one who has been born king of the Jews? We saw his star when it rose and have come to worship him.”
6. Jesus will be preceded by a messenger announcing his arrival.
Isaiah 40:3; Malachi 3:1 – A voice of one calling: “In the wilderness prepare the way for the Lord;…Behold, I send my messenger, and he will prepare the way before me.”
Matthew 3:3 – For this is he who was spoken of by the prophet Isaiah when he said, “The voice of one crying in the wilderness: ‘Prepare the way of the Lord; make his paths straight.’”
7. Jesus’ manner of death.
Psalm 22:16 – Dogs surround me, a pack of villains encircles me; they pierce my hands and my feet.
Mark 15:24; John 19:37 – “And they crucified him… And again another Scripture says, ‘They will look on him whom they have pierced.”
Peter Stoner (June 16, 1888 – March 21, 1980) was Chairman of the departments of mathematics and astronomy at Pasadena City College until 1953; Chairman of the science division, Westmont College, 1953–57; Professor Emeritus of Science, Westmont College; and Professor Emeritus of Mathematics and Astronomy, Pasadena City College. In his classic, Science Speaks, Stoner calculated the following:
“The probability for just eight prophecies being fulfilled is around 1 in 10¹⁷ (1 in 100 quadrillion), and for 48 prophecies, it’s 1 in 10¹⁵⁷, making accidental fulfillment statistically impossible.”
